1 00:00:00,000 --> 00:00:00,110 2 00:00:00,110 --> 00:00:04,850 >> დინამიკები 1: როდესაც მომხმარებლის დააწკაპუნეთ Dropoff ღილაკი index.html ეს თქვენ 3 00:00:04,850 --> 00:00:06,370 მოუწოდა dropoff ფუნქცია. 4 00:00:06,370 --> 00:00:08,720 და ეს არის ჩვენი სამუშაო განახორციელოს, რომ. 5 00:00:08,720 --> 00:00:13,390 In dropoff, ჩვენ გვინდა წაშლა მგზავრები shuttle მხოლოდ იმ შემთხვევაში, 6 00:00:13,390 --> 00:00:17,950 ჩვენ სპექტრი მათი დანიშნულების, მათი საცხოვრებელი სახლი. 7 00:00:17,950 --> 00:00:22,500 ასე dropoff ექნება თუ არა Shuttle არის სპექტრს ნებისმიერი 8 00:00:22,500 --> 00:00:27,410 სახლები და წაშალოს ნებისმიერი საჭირო მგზავრი საწყისი Shuttle. 9 00:00:27,410 --> 00:00:30,230 >> ასე როგორ უნდა შეამოწმოთ, თუ ჩვენ ამ ქედის ნებისმიერი სახლები? 10 00:00:30,230 --> 00:00:35,840 ასევე, კიდევ ერთხელ, ჩვენ გამოიყენონ shuttle.distance ფუნქცია, გადადის 11 00:00:35,840 --> 00:00:40,200 გრძედი და განედი წერტილი რომ ჩვენ შემოწმების წინააღმდეგ. 12 00:00:40,200 --> 00:00:41,940 მაგრამ რა არის ის ქულები? 13 00:00:41,940 --> 00:00:46,420 >> ისე, სახლები მასივი, თუ გახსოვთ, in houses.js, ინახავს 14 00:00:46,420 --> 00:00:52,000 გრძედი და განედი თითოეული სახლი ასოციაციურ მასივში, სადაც ყველა 15 00:00:52,000 --> 00:00:55,190 ინდექსი არის სახელი, რომ სახლში. 16 00:00:55,190 --> 00:00:59,520 მაშინ, ამოიღონ მგზავრი, ასევე, მხოლოდ თუ ჩვენ სპექტრი მათი სახლი, 17 00:00:59,520 --> 00:01:03,460 მათ უნდათ, ასე რომ, კიდევ ერთხელ, მახსოვს, რომ [? მგზავრები?] 18 00:01:03,460 --> 00:01:08,030 ინახავს სახლში, რომ ყველა სამგზავრო სურს წასვლა. 19 00:01:08,030 --> 00:01:10,880 თუ ისინი ფარგლებში სპექტრი მათი სახლში, მაშინ ჩვენ ამოიღონ, რომ 20 00:01:10,880 --> 00:01:14,440 სამგზავრო საწყისი shuttle.seats და მითითებული თანამდებობაზე 21 00:01:14,440 --> 00:01:15,690 მასივი [? 0?]. 22 00:01:15,690 --> 00:01:17,547